There are several ways to do this. I'm going to show you how to use WiFi since it is easy and does not require a wire. First I'm assuming your PC/Laptop is running Windows. If not, your are on your own.
On the PlayBook main screen, tap the gear in the upper-right corner. Scroll down the left side to Storage & Sharing. On the right side, slide over the Wi-Fi Sharing to on. It will automatically turn on File Sharing and will warn you that you should set a password. Do so if you wish.
Go to your computer and open Network. In the network window look for PLAYBOOK-???? where the ???? is your PB identifier. Open the PLAYBOOK-???? and you should see two folders. Open the one labeled Media. Under there open Documents. Drag and drop the files into the Documents folder. Close all the Windows on your computer. Shut off sharing on your PB if you want. You are done.

Box.com, DropBox, and Google Docs are all integrated into Files and Folders file manager. Upload your files to your cloud service of choice, then use Files and Folders to copy the files to a local folder on your Playbook.
